How to fill out 8 hour infection control

How to fill out 8 hour infection control
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information and materials for 8 hour infection control.
02
Make sure to have a clean and sanitized work area to prevent the spread of any infections.
03
Follow the guidelines and protocols provided by your healthcare facility or organization.
04
Use personal protective equipment (PPE) such as gloves, masks, and gowns as required.
05
Wash your hands thoroughly before and after any contact with patients or contaminated items.
06
Practice proper respiratory hygiene by covering your mouth and nose when coughing or sneezing.
07
Clean and disinfect all surfaces, equipment, and instruments regularly.
08
Educate yourself and stay updated on the latest infection control practices and guidelines.
09
Document all the steps taken and any incidents or concerns that arise during the 8 hour infection control process.
10
Seek support and guidance from your supervisors or infection control professionals if needed.
